Compiling in Win32 exposed additional warnings I will clean up. Thanks for
this comment! I am also going to build with Visual Studio 2015 in 32-bit and
64-bit to make sure they are all cleaned up. I have Win64 VS2010 building
without any warnings at this point. In addition I found that the tutorial
CMakeLists.txt assumes ZLIB is configured so I changed it to be conditional on
the ZLIB library.
